How to Convert 155 lbs to kg

To convert 155 lbs to kg, you need to know the conversion factor:

One pound (lb) is equal to 0.453592 kilograms (kg). Thus, the calculation will look like this:

Step 1:

1 lb = 0.453592 kg

Step 2:

155 lbs × 0.453592 = 70.31 kg

Now you understand that 155 lbs is approximately equal to 70.31 kg. This quick conversion is helpful in everyday life if you live in a country with a metric system.
